ARRAY ANTENNA
An array antenna includes a flexible substrate formed by stacked liquid crystal polymer (LCP) layers and has at least one feed point. At least one serial antenna is arranged on the flexible substrate, and a microstrip is extended from the feed point to connect a plurality of radiating elements in series to form the serial antenna. The tail end one of the radiating elements of the serial antenna is connected to one end of a ground microstrip, and another end of the ground microstrip is short-circuited to the ground. The length of the ground microstrip is approximately one fourth of the wavelength of the center frequency of the array antenna. Feeding sections where microstrips feeding to the radiating elements are in a horn and/or groove shape. Desired frequency and bandwidth may be obtained by adjusting lengths and widths of feeding sections respectively.

ANTENNA GOOSENECK DEVICE AND COMMUNICATION SYSTEM TO MITIGATE NEAR-FIELD EFFECTS OF CO-LOCALIZED ANTENNAS ON PORTABLE RADIO PRODUCTS AND METHODS OF USE THEREOF
A communication system comprising a radio device and a gooseneck device. The radio device may be coupled to a first antenna and a second antenna. A feedline gooseneck device may be coupled to the first antenna. The feedline gooseneck device may include a coaxial cable coupled between the mobile device and the first antenna and a ferrite element positioned along the coaxial cable. The ferrite element is configured to reduce EM interaction between the first and the second antenna. The ferrite element may be one of a plurality of ferrite elements and the feedline gooseneck device may further include a plurality of flexible elements positioned adjacent to each of the plurality of ferrite elements. The ferrite element(s) may surround at least 60% of a length of the coaxial cable. The first antenna may be removably coupled to the gooseneck device. The system allows for reduction of an amount of electromagnetic interference between the first antenna coupled to the gooseneck and the second antenna.

EYEWEAR WITH APERTURE TUNED DIELECTRIC LOADED MULTI-BAND ANTENNA
Eyewear including a dipole antenna having a first leg and a second leg, wherein the first leg includes at least a portion of a battery, such as a conductive case of the battery. An antenna feed is coupled to the dipole antenna between the second leg and the battery. The second leg may comprise a flexible printed circuit (FPC), and the second leg is an active leg. The second leg has a first portion and a second portion. The first portion and the second portion may have the same physical length. The first portion may be dielectrically loaded with a high permittivity loaded material, and the second portion may be dielectrically loaded with a low permittivity loaded material.
Deployable tile aperture devices, systems, and methods
Deployable tile aperture devices, systems, and methods are provided in accordance with various embodiments. Some embodiments include a device that may include multiple aperture tiles that may be coupled with each other such the multiple aperture tiles have a stacked stowed configuration and a flat deployed configuration. Some embodiments include one or more tension chords configured to deploy the multiple aperture tiles when tension is applied to the one or more tension chords. The flat deployed configuration may include at least one side edge portion of each aperture tile from the multiple aperture tiles making contact with another side edge portion of another aperture tile from the multiple aperture tiles. The flat deployed configuration may form one or more continuous face surfaces formed from the multiple aperture tiles. The one or more tension chords may pass through at least a portion of one or more of the multiple aperture tiles.
